Main Dashboard Sectionsβ
1. Status Overviewβ
Quick glance at your monitoring health:
- All Monitors - Total number of configured monitors
- Online Services - Currently healthy services
- Offline Services - Services experiencing issues
- Response Time - Average response time across all monitors
2. Monitor Gridβ
Visual representation of all your monitors:
- π’ Green - Service is online and responding
- π΄ Red - Service is offline or failing
- π‘ Yellow - Service has warnings or degraded performance
- βͺ Gray - Monitor is paused or pending first check
3. Recent Activity Feedβ
Latest events across your monitoring infrastructure:
- Downtime incidents
- Recovery notifications
- New monitors added
- Configuration changes
π Monitor Cardsβ
Each monitor displays key information at a glance:
Status Indicatorsβ
π’ Online - Service responding normally
π΄ Offline - Service not responding
π‘ Warning - Partial issues detected
βͺ Pending - First check in progress
π΅ Paused - Monitoring temporarily disabled
Key Metricsβ
- Current Status - Current up/down state
- Uptime % - Availability over selected time period
- Performance Grade - Automated A/B/C/F quality rating (π’ A / π‘ B / π C / π΄ F)
- Response Time - Latest response time measurement
- Last Checked - When the service was last verified
- Location - Which monitoring agent performed the check (manage agents)

Keyboard Shortcutsβ
- Ctrl/Cmd + K - Quick search
- Ctrl/Cmd + N - New monitor
- Ctrl/Cmd + R - Refresh dashboard
- Ctrl/Cmd + / - Show keyboard shortcuts

π― Best Practicesβ
Dashboard Organizationβ
- Prioritize critical services - Place most important monitors first
- Use descriptive names - Make monitors easily identifiable
- Group related services - Organize by application or team
- Set appropriate check intervals - Balance accuracy with resource usage
Monitoring Strategyβ
- Start simple - Begin with basic HTTP checks
- Add complexity gradually - Implement advanced features over time
- Monitor dependencies - Check supporting services too
- Plan for maintenance - Use pause feature during deployments

π§ Troubleshootingβ
Common Issuesβ
Dashboard not loading?
- Check your internet connection
- Clear browser cache and cookies
- Try incognito/private browsing mode
- Check if JavaScript is enabled
Monitors not updating?
- Verify monitor configuration is correct
- Check if monitoring agents are online (Agent Management)
- Review recent error messages
- Test endpoint manually
